NettetAfter beating with a construction mixer, a homogeneous, dense mass should be obtained. To insulate the chimney pipe or decorative stove, you can use special plaster. The solution is applied to the insulated surface with stains using a spatula. Lumps of the solution must be distributed evenly over the entire pipe area. NettetThe reason for the gap between the wood and the stove pipe is to prevent overheated pipe from causing a flash fire in the wood. Even though you probably have double-wall pipe through the wall (which is what allows for the wood surrounding it) you still want something between the wood and the pipe that can act as an insulator against much … Nettet21. jan. 2010 · If you want to insulate around a flue, I recommend you use the products that your liner manufacturer approves of in the instructions for your liner - most will refer to a ceramic fibre blanket, 1/2" thick. Nettet17. apr. 2024 · Install the insulation according to the manufacturer's directions. Before insulating, however, seal all openings in your duct work; insulating duct work with unsealed openings is an exercise in futility at best. The highest R-value duct insulation for rigid fiber board is R-6.5 to R-6.8, which is made of polyisocyanurate foam (polyiso for short).
